在选择云服务器经济型e实例(如阿里云的ECS经济型e实例)并部署Linux系统时,应根据你的具体用途、性能需求、软件兼容性以及维护成本来综合考虑。以下是关于Linux发行版选择的建议:
一、经济型e实例的特点
经济型e实例通常具有以下特点:
- CPU性能有限(可能采用突发性能实例,如t5/t6类型)
- 内存较小(如1GB~2GB)
- 成本低,适合轻量级应用
- 适用于个人网站、学习环境、测试项目、小型服务等
因此,在选择操作系统时,应优先考虑轻量、稳定、资源占用少的Linux发行版。
二、推荐的Linux发行版
1. Alibaba Cloud Linux(推荐首选)
- 阿里云官方定制的Linux系统,专为阿里云环境优化。
- 基于CentOS/Rocky Linux,稳定性高。
- 内核和驱动针对云环境调优,性能更好。
- 免费使用,无额外授权费用。
- 完美支持e实例,尤其适合阿里云用户。
✅ 推荐场景:生产环境、Web服务、后端API、Docker部署等。
提示:如果使用阿里云,优先选择 Alibaba Cloud Linux 3(基于RHEL 8/9)
2. Ubuntu Server LTS(次选推荐)
- 社区活跃,文档丰富,适合新手。
- 软件包生态强大,安装软件方便(apt)。
- Ubuntu 20.04 LTS 或 22.04 LTS 是长期支持版本,稳定性好。
- 对开发者友好,适合搭建开发环境或部署Node.js、Python等应用。
⚠️ 注意:相比Alibaba Cloud Linux略重一些,但对1GB以上内存的e实例仍可良好运行。
✅ 推荐场景:学习、开发测试、中小型网站、容器化应用。
3. CentOS Stream / Rocky Linux / AlmaLinux
- 类似于传统的CentOS,适合习惯RHEL生态的用户。
- 使用
yum/dnf包管理,企业级应用兼容性好。 - CentOS Stream是滚动更新,Rocky/Alma是社区重建的稳定替代。
⚠️ 注意:CentOS 8已停止维护,建议选择 Rocky Linux 9 或 AlmaLinux 9。
✅ 推荐场景:需要RPM生态、企业级中间件部署。
4. Debian(轻量稳定之选)
- 极其稳定,资源占用低,适合低配e实例(如1GB内存)。
- 软件更新保守,安全性高。
- 包管理使用
apt,与Ubuntu兼容。
✅ 推荐场景:静态网站、小工具服务、长期运行的后台任务。
❌ 不推荐的系统
- Windows Server:资源消耗大,许可费用高,不适合经济型e实例。
- Fedora / Arch Linux:更新频繁,不适合生产环境。
- Kali Linux:专用于渗透测试,不适合作为通用服务器系统。
三、选择建议总结
| 使用场景 | 推荐系统 |
|---|---|
| 阿里云最佳性能与兼容性 | ✅ Alibaba Cloud Linux 3 |
| 学习/开发/新手入门 | ✅ Ubuntu 22.04 LTS |
| 资源紧张(1GB内存) | ✅ Debian 12 |
| 企业级应用/RPM生态 | ✅ Rocky Linux 9 |
| Docker/容器部署 | ✅ Alibaba Cloud Linux 或 Ubuntu |
四、其他建议
- 选择64位系统:即使配置低,也应使用64位系统以获得更好的兼容性和未来扩展性。
- 关闭不必要的服务:在低配实例上,精简系统可提升响应速度。
- 定期更新系统:保持安全补丁更新,尤其是暴露公网的服务。
结论
对于阿里云经济型e实例,首选 Alibaba Cloud Linux 3,其次是 Ubuntu 22.04 LTS 或 Debian 12,根据你的技术背景和应用场景灵活选择即可。
如果你主要用于建站、学习或跑轻量服务,Ubuntu 或 Debian 都是非常稳妥的选择。
CLOUD云计算